Description
Nickel boride is a chemical compound with the formula NiB, characterized by its -35 mesh size and 99% purity. It is a refractory material with a silver-green appearance and possesses unique chemical properties, making it a versatile substance in various applications.
Uses
Used in Chemical Industry:
Nickel boride is used as an efficient catalyst and reducing agent for various chemical reactions. Its ability to act as a heterogeneous hydrogenation catalyst makes it a valuable component in the production of various chemicals and compounds.
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
In the pharmaceutical industry, nickel boride is utilized in a protection-deprotection scheme for triterpenoid ketones. This application aids in the synthesis of complex organic molecules, which are essential in the development of new drugs and therapeutic agents.
Used in Research and Development:
Nickel boride is also used in research and development settings, particularly for the cleavage of thioacetals. This application contributes to the advancement of chemical synthesis techniques and the discovery of novel compounds with potential applications in various fields.

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 12007-00-0 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 1,2,0,0 and 7 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 12007-00:
(7*1)+(6*2)+(5*0)+(4*0)+(3*7)+(2*0)+(1*0)=40
40 % 10 = 0
So 12007-00-0 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
